IMAGINE, Neutron Crystallography Diffractometer
High Flux Isotope Reactor (HFIR), Oak Ridge National Laboratory
Call for proposals for experiments anticipated to run from August through 
December 2013

You are invited to apply for beam time on the neutron quasi-Laue diffractometer 
IMAGINE, at the High Flux Isotope Reactor. Proposal will be accepted via the 
web-based proposal system until NOON Wednesday, July 31, 2013.
This call is for experiments anticipated to run from August through December 
2013.
